Meet Noah!



Noah was found along with his sister Noelle abandoned on the streets of southern CA, suffering from mange and untreated skin infections. Despite Noah's rough start to life he is bursting with love and affection and has not lost any trust in humans. Noah is around 9 months of age and a pit bull mix type pup. Noah is being treated for his demodex mange ( not contagious)  and well on his way to looking and feeling his best. He is currently here at our facility and is learning all kinds of good things. Noah is working on his crate training, potty training, and socilization. Noah can be unsure of some dogs at first, but once he knows they are friendly he enjoys playing. Noah is still learning appropriate play and boundaries around other dogs and does well with other well balanced female dogs, his size or larger at this time. Noah can be a sensitive guy and is working on building some confidence. Noah's ideal home would be with a person or family, who can continue his training, socialization and set clear boundaries for him so he can mature into a well balanced adult dog. Their adoption process

1.

Submit Application

2.

Interview

IF your application is selected as a match for a dog, we will reach out to your references and request a home tour video.

3.

Meet the Pet

IF your references and home tour video are approved, you will be invited out to our rescue location to meet our dog(s).

4.

Sign Adoption Contract

IF the meet & greet goes well, you will be asked to pay the adoption fee, sign the contract, and are ready to take your new dog home!

Additional adoption info

Please note, we have a thorough adoption process in order to make the best match possible for both our dogs and our adopters! There are times when we schedule a few meet & greets for one dog prior to making a final decision.
